The safest seating position on buses, trains, and airplanes
The safest seating positions on buses, trains, and airplanes have been studied, and although the specific safest spot can vary depending on the circumstances of an accident, some general trends have emerged based on research and accident data:
1. Buses:
- Seats near the rear: Studies suggest that the safest seats on buses are typically located toward the rear. This is because most accidents, especially rear-end collisions, impact the front of the vehicle. Additionally, rear seats have the added benefit of being away from the main exit in case of emergencies, though this could also be a disadvantage in some situations.
- Seats by the aisle: If you're traveling in a crowded bus, sitting by the aisle can help in case of an evacuation, as you can quickly exit the vehicle.
2. Trains:
- Near the middle of the train: The safest spot on a train is typically near the middle or closer to the center of the vehicle. The reasoning here is that the front and rear sections of the train are more susceptible to damage in collisions, especially when the train crashes or derails.
- Facing forward: Sitting in a seat facing the direction of travel can reduce the likelihood of injury during sudden stops or accidents because your body is better aligned with the force of impact.
3. Airplanes:
- Seats over the wings: In airplanes, the safest seats tend to be those located over the wings, according to various studies on aviation safety. This area is considered to have the most structural integrity and is typically the least affected in an emergency landing or crash.
- Rear of the plane: Some studies suggest that passengers seated in the rear of the airplane have a slightly higher survival rate in crashes. This is partly due to the rear of the plane being further away from the impact zone in many crash scenarios.
- Aisle seats: While not necessarily the safest in terms of crash survival, aisle seats can be advantageous in case of an emergency evacuation because they allow quicker access to the aisles and exits.
General Safety Tips:
- Wear your seatbelt: This applies to all modes of transportation. Seatbelts are essential for safety in the event of a sudden stop or crash.
- Stay alert: Be aware of your surroundings and know the nearest exit routes, particularly in trains and airplanes.
- Follow the crew's instructions: In emergencies, crew members are trained to guide passengers to safety, so following their instructions is crucial.
Ultimately, the safest seat varies based on the type of accident, and it's important to remember that overall safety is also about how you respond to an emergency and whether you're following proper safety measures like wearing a seatbelt and remaining calm.
